#1 -- Check out your local community college. If you child scores high enough, they could take classes there. My local community college has two types of programs for high schoolers....Collegiate High which is "high school" at the college. In essence, they have a counselor and a principal to oversee their courses and attendance. The other option is Dual Enrollment. You do everything, yourself in terms of registering for classes and making sure your child is attending the classes.
